Star Equity Holdings Inc (STRR) - Total Assets
Based on the latest financial reports, Star Equity Holdings Inc (STRR) holds total assets worth $113.23 Million USD as of December 2025.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ments. Annual Total Assets for Star Equity Holdings Inc (2000–2025)
The table below shows the annual total assets of Star Equity Holdings Inc from 2000 to 2025.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-12-31 | $113.23 Million | +115.34% |
| 2024-12-31 | $52.58 Million | -13.74% |
| 2023-12-31 | $60.96 Million | -10.28% |
| 2022-12-31 | $67.94 Million | +10.94% |
| 2021-12-31 | $61.24 Million | -31.54% |
| 2020-12-31 | $89.46 Million | -1.22% |
| 2019-12-31 | $90.56 Million | +78.99% |
| 2018-12-31 | $50.59 Million | -24.15% |
| 2017-12-31 | $66.70 Million | -37.23% |
| 2016-12-31 | $106.26 Million | +65.74% |
| 2015-12-31 | $64.11 Million | +53.01% |
| 2014-12-31 | $41.90 Million | +1.09% |
| 2013-12-31 | $41.45 Million | -7.70% |
| 2012-12-31 | $44.91 Million | -10.23% |
| 2011-12-31 | $50.03 Million | -4.57% |
| 2010-12-31 | $52.42 Million | -10.68% |
| 2009-12-31 | $58.69 Million | -4.10% |
| 2008-12-31 | $61.20 Million | -11.33% |
| 2007-12-31 | $69.02 Million | -0.38% |
| 2006-12-31 | $69.28 Million | -7.02% |
| 2005-12-31 | $74.50 Million | -13.39% |
| 2004-12-31 | $86.02 Million | +144.67% |
| 2003-12-31 | $35.16 Million | +6.16% |
| 2002-12-31 | $33.12 Million | +43.68% |
| 2000-12-31 | $23.05 Million | -- |
About Star Equity Holdings Inc
Star Equity Holdings, Inc. operates as a diversified multi-industry holding company in Australia, the United States, the United Kingdom, and internationally. It operates through four segments: Building Solutions, Business Services, Energy Services, and Investments.
